Before we begin disassembling, we would like to point out once again that a number of special tools are required, without which the work can only be carried out with considerable difficulty. The corresponding spare part numbers for these tools are indicated in the appropriate places in the text, but you should first try to find them or rent them.
Before disassembling, drain the gearbox oil. To do this, use a 17mm Allen key to remove the drain plug on the underside of the gearbox housing. Remove any dirt from the outside of the gearbox.
Basic disassembly of the gearbox housing
Gearbox assembly diagram
1 - bolt, tightened with a torque of 14 Nm
2 - washer
3 - gearbox cover (changed)
4 - seal
5 - bolt, tightened to 25 Nm
6 - guide pin
7 - gear shift fork, 5th gear
8 - bolt M10, tightened with a torque of 80 Nm
9 - bushing (changed)
10 - gear shift clutch, 5th gear
11 - synchronous shift sleeve, 5th gear
12 - spring
13 - synchronizing ring, 5th gear
14 - gear shift pinion, 5th gear
15 - needle roller bearing
16 - gear shift pinion, 5th gear
17 - bolt, tightened to 25 Nm
18 - guide pin
19 - O-ring seal
20 - bolt, tightened to 25 Nm
21 - bearing shell
22 - gearbox housing
23 - cork
24 - drive flange
25 - locking ring
26 - bolt, tightened to 25 Nm
27 - switching mechanism
28 - clutch housing
29 - bushing
30 - cork
31 - magnet
32 - tachometer drive
33 - O-ring seal
34 - guide bushing with seal
35 - bolt, tightened to 14 Nm
36 - bolt, tightened to 25 Nm
37, 38 - bolts, tightened to 30 Nm
39 - starter motor shaft sleeve
If changes are specified, they must be taken into account if they affect the repair of the gearbox. The following description provides references to the figure
Unscrew the gearbox cover (3) and remove the seal (4). The cover shown in the figure is flat. As a result of modification of the gear pinion mounting for the fifth gear, the cover is now higher. If the gearbox cover (3) is mounted with the gearbox installed, then after installation, check the oil level in the following manner.
The gearbox is filled with oil to the edge of the filler hole and the plug is screwed back in.
